11 Quick and Easy Crochet Gift Ideas
1. Round Nested Crochet Baskets

A practical and stylish gift that's quick to make, especially when using chunky yarn.
These baskets are perfect for organizing small items or displaying décor.
Nesting baskets add versatility, and the simple stitches make it beginner-friendly.
A thoughtful and functional gift that looks more time-intensive than it is.
2. 5 Petal Flower Crochet Coasters

Cute and functional, these coasters are perfect for a small but impactful gift.
Quick to make, they use minimal yarn and are beginner-friendly. The floral design adds charm to any kitchen or coffee table.
Pair a few together for a ready-to-gift set.
3. Easy Ribbed Crochet Beanie

Warm, stylish, and quick to crochet, this beanie is perfect for last-minute gift-giving.
The ribbed stitch adds texture and interest without adding complexity.
Beginner-friendly and versatile in color, it works for teens, adults, or anyone in need of a cozy accessory.
4. Easy Crochet Sunflower Bag Charm

A small, cheerful project that's quick to finish and uses leftover yarn.
This charm is perfect for adding a handmade touch to a bag or keys.
Beginner-friendly and customizable in color, it's a thoughtful gift that feels personal without taking hours.

5. Crochet Bear Coasters

Practical and adorable, these coasters are perfect for anyone who loves small handmade touches.
Quick to crochet and simple to personalize, they're ideal for a last-minute gift.
A fun, functional project that's beginner-friendly and looks cute in multiples.
6. Crochet Heart Keychain

Tiny but thoughtful, this keychain is perfect for adding a handmade accent to keys or bags.
Uses minimal yarn and works up quickly. Beginner-friendly with a polished result, it's a perfect last-minute gift that still feels personal.
7. Chunky Crochet Scarf with Fringe - Brooklyn

A cozy, stylish accessory that works up quickly with chunky yarn.
The fringe adds texture and flair while keeping the project simple.
sGreat for beginners and a gift anyone would appreciate during chilly months. Quick to finish, yet it feels special.
8. Gummy Bear Crochet Keychain

Small, playful, and perfect for using scraps, this keychain works up quickly. It's beginner-friendly and makes a cute, special gift.
Ideal for teens, kids, or anyone who loves tiny, handmade charms. A perfect last-minute addition to a gift bundle.
9. Chunky Crochet Fingerless Gloves

Quick to crochet and practical for cooler weather, these gloves are great for gifting.
The open-finger design keeps them versatile and functional.
Beginner-friendly, cozy, and stylish, they're a thoughtful handmade accessory that doesn't take long to finish.
10. Crochet Bag - Layla

A versatile bag that works up faster than it looks, especially with medium-weight yarn.
It's stylish, practical, and beginner-friendly. Perfect as a standalone gift or paired with smaller items like a keychain or charm for a coordinated bundle.
11. Easy Crochet Mug Cozy

A tiny project that's perfect for pairing with a mug as a gift.
Quick, beginner-friendly, and functional, it adds a cozy touch to someone's kitchen or office.
Works well with scrap yarn or custom colors for a personalized last-minute present.
